The global machine vision market size is expected to reach USD 21.17 billion by 2028, according to a new report by Grand View Research, Inc. It is expected to expand at a CAGR of 6.9% from 2021 to 2028. The ability of machine vision systems to process a large amount of information in a fraction of seconds is a major factor driving the market. The quick processing ability of machine vision systems is paving the way for manufacturers to achieve new milestones in manufacturing products with negligible defects. Moreover, the increasing adoption of robots across the industrial sectors is leading to the application of vision-guided robotic systems. Industrial verticals such as automotive, pharmaceutical, packaging, and food and beverage are prominent sectors where robotic systems are used, eventually fueling the demand for machine vision systems.
Machine
vision technology encompasses various components in order to capture images of
products to analyze them depending on different parameters of quality and
safety. The technology is a combination of software and hardware that provides
operational control to devices to execute functions, such as capturing and
processing images and measuring various characteristics required for decision
making. Major components of the system comprise lighting, lens, image
sensors, vision processing, and communication devices. Machine vision systems
assist in resolving complicated industrial tasks with reliability.
Industrial
machine vision systems are usually more robust and demand high reliability,
stability, and accuracy as compared to those used in institutional or
educational applications. They cost lesser than systems used in military,
aerospace, defense, and government applications. These factors are expected to
lead to greater adaptability of the technology in the industrial sectors. In
addition, the robotic vision systems used across the industries are leading to
the increasing adoption of the technology, thereby strengthening the overall
market growth.
The
technology has proven to be of key importance in the area of manufacturing and
quality control owing to the increasing need for quality inspection and
production. In addition, the growing automation in the industrial segments is
facilitating the growth of the market worldwide at a considerable rate.

The
automotive end-use industry held the largest market share in 2020. The
inspection process, which includes error-proofing and presence/absence
checking, is responsible for the adoption of machine vision in the automotive
industry. The food and beverage industry is expected to register the highest
growth rate in the coming seven years owing to the use of machine vision
systems in the packaging and bottling operations.

The
industry is facing challenges due to the lack of awareness among users about
the rapidly advancing machine vision technology. Moreover, the complexity of
integrating machine vision systems is the major difficulty being faced by
manufacturers, which is restraining the smoother growth of the industry.
